The Coppertone Girl Sign is not just a mere advertisement; it stands as a cherished piece of Miami's history and culture. Erected in the mid-20th century, this whimsical sign features the iconic image of a young girl with a playful dog, both basking in the sun, promoting the famous Coppertone sunscreen. For tourists, it serves as an essential backdrop for photos, encapsulating the essence of Miami's beach lifestyle and sunny disposition. The sign is located in the Upper East Side of Miami, where it draws visitors looking to capture a snapshot of nostalgia. As you approach the sign, you'll notice its vibrant colors and vintage charm, a testament to the artistic flair that characterizes Miami. Nearby, you'll find charming cafes and shops, making it a perfect spot to relax and soak in the local atmosphere. While the area is rich in history and culture, it's essential to keep in mind that parking can be a challenge, especially during peak tourist seasons. Consider using public transportation or rideshare services to ease your visit. Getting There
-
Public Transit
If you are in downtown Miami, you can take the Metrorail Orange Line to the Earlington Heights station. From there, transfer to the Metrobus Route 2 towards North Miami Beach. Get off at the stop at 79th Street and Biscayne Blvd. Walk north on Biscayne Blvd for about 10 minutes, and you will reach the Coppertone Girl Sign located at 7300 Biscayne Blvd.
-
Public Transit
If you are near Miami Beach, take the South Beach Local bus to the Lincoln Road Mall stop. From there, switch to the Route 119 bus towards the Airport and get off at the 79th Street and Biscayne Blvd stop. Walk a short distance north along Biscayne Blvd to find the Coppertone Girl Sign at 7300 Biscayne Blvd.
-
Walking
If you are staying in the Upper East Side neighborhood, you can easily walk to the Coppertone Girl Sign. Start at the intersection of NE 79th Street and Biscayne Blvd. Head north on Biscayne Blvd for about 5 minutes, and you will see the iconic sign at 7300 Biscayne Blvd.
